diff options
| author | bors <bors@rust-lang.org> | 2015-07-17 22:27:37 +0000 |
|---|---|---|
| committer | bors <bors@rust-lang.org> | 2015-07-17 22:27:37 +0000 |
| commit | 5df259b9da287043e8284eb53d61a17b89a89bee (patch) | |
| tree | 474e6bafb9e6dc80a3b89e3561e89198269a2fcf /src/libsyntax | |
| parent | e05ac3938bcbdd616930bb010a3bbfa35f22850e (diff) | |
| parent | 8638dc7f9ae55d9b3102d152b2e2cca92bb83acf (diff) | |
| download | rust-5df259b9da287043e8284eb53d61a17b89a89bee.tar.gz rust-5df259b9da287043e8284eb53d61a17b89a89bee.zip | |
Auto merge of #27098 - Manishearth:rollup, r=Manishearth
- Successful merges: #26777, #27067, #27071, #27081, #27091, #27094, #27095 - Failed merges:
Diffstat (limited to 'src/libsyntax')
| -rw-r--r-- | src/libsyntax/ast.rs | 2 | ||||
| -rw-r--r-- | src/libsyntax/diagnostics/macros.rs | 6 |
2 files changed, 7 insertions, 1 deletions
diff --git a/src/libsyntax/ast.rs b/src/libsyntax/ast.rs index e844b206cc0..a944acad84d 100644 --- a/src/libsyntax/ast.rs +++ b/src/libsyntax/ast.rs @@ -1104,7 +1104,7 @@ impl TokenTree { tts: vec![TtToken(sp, token::Ident(token::str_to_ident("doc"), token::Plain)), TtToken(sp, token::Eq), - TtToken(sp, token::Literal(token::Str_(name), None))], + TtToken(sp, token::Literal(token::StrRaw(name, 0), None))], close_span: sp, })) } diff --git a/src/libsyntax/diagnostics/macros.rs b/src/libsyntax/diagnostics/macros.rs index 055ade46a3f..669b930ecc9 100644 --- a/src/libsyntax/diagnostics/macros.rs +++ b/src/libsyntax/diagnostics/macros.rs @@ -63,6 +63,9 @@ macro_rules! fileline_help { macro_rules! register_diagnostics { ($($code:tt),*) => ( $(register_diagnostic! { $code })* + ); + ($($code:tt),*,) => ( + $(register_diagnostic! { $code })* ) } @@ -70,5 +73,8 @@ macro_rules! register_diagnostics { macro_rules! register_long_diagnostics { ($($code:tt: $description:tt),*) => ( $(register_diagnostic! { $code, $description })* + ); + ($($code:tt: $description:tt),*,) => ( + $(register_diagnostic! { $code, $description })* ) } |
